Understanding Gym Equipment Safety
Gym equipment safety involves using machines and tools correctly to prevent accidents. It’s essential to familiarise yourself with the safety features and guidelines of each piece of equipment before use. Here are some fundamental tips:
- Read the manual or instructions before using new equipment.
- Inspect equipment for damage or malfunction regularly.
- Use appropriate footwear to avoid slips and falls.
- Maintain proper posture and form during exercises.
Common Injuries and How to Prevent Them
Understanding common gym injuries can help you take preventive measures. Here are some frequent injuries and tips to avoid them:
Strains and Sprains
These occur when muscles or ligaments are overstretched or torn. To prevent:
- Warm up thoroughly before workouts.
- Incorporate flexibility exercises into your routine.
- Listen to your body and rest when needed.
Back Injuries
Back injuries can result from poor posture or excessive weight lifting. Prevent them by:
- Maintaining a neutral spine during lifts.
- Using equipment like exercise benches for support.
- Starting with lighter weights and gradually increasing.
What You Can DIY vs When to Call a Pro
While regular maintenance of gym equipment can be handled independently, certain situations require professional assistance. Here’s a quick guide:
| DIY Tasks | Professional Help |
|---|---|
| Cleaning equipment | Fixing electrical issues |
| Tightening bolts and screws | Repairing mechanical parts |
| Inspecting for wear and tear | Equipment calibration |
Creating a Safe Workout Environment
A safe workout environment minimises the risk of injuries. Follow these guidelines:
- Ensure adequate lighting in your workout space.
- Keep the area clean and clutter-free.
- Use quality mats for exercises involving floor work.
Checklist for Safe Gym Practices
Here’s a handy checklist to ensure safety during your workouts:
- Check equipment stability before use.
- Wear appropriate attire, including supportive shoes.
- Stay hydrated and take breaks as needed.
- Warm up and cool down properly.
